Breaking Down the Features of Valterra Quick Drain Standard RV Sewer Hose 20ft, Bagged
Specifications
The Valterra Quick Drain Standard RV Sewer Hose 20ft, Bagged boasts a 3″ inner diameter, which is standard for most RV sewer connections and ensures adequate flow capacity. Its construction features an 8 mil vinyl cover, designed to offer resilience against harsh weather conditions and common RV chemicals. The hose is wire reinforced, providing structural integrity and helping to maintain its shape during use. At a generous 20-foot extended hose length, it offers ample reach for various hook-up situations, and it comes conveniently bagged for storage and transport.
These specifications translate directly into practical benefits. The 3″ inner diameter means you’re unlikely to experience clogs due to restricted flow. The 8 mil vinyl cover is crucial for protecting the hose from UV damage and the corrosive effects of toilet chemicals, ensuring longevity. The wire reinforcement is key to preventing annoying kinks that can halt drainage and cause back-ups. Finally, the 20-foot length is significantly more versatile than shorter hoses, allowing you to connect even when the sewer port is further away, and the bagged packaging keeps it tidy between uses.

Durability & Maintenance
Based on my experience, the Valterra Quick Drain Standard RV Sewer Hose 20ft, Bagged appears built for longevity. The 8 mil vinyl cover and wire reinforced construction offer good resistance to abrasion and stress, common issues for sewer hoses. After several months of regular use, there are no visible cracks, tears, or signs of premature wear.
Maintenance is refreshingly simple. A quick flush with water after each use is usually sufficient, and allowing it to dry before storing in its bag helps preserve the vinyl. Potential failure points, common to all sewer hoses, would likely be at the crimped fittings if subjected to extreme force or repeated stress, but the Valterra fittings have held up well so far. It’s designed as a reusable item, not a disposable one, and it seems to live up to that expectation.
Accessories and Customization Options
The primary accessory included with the Valterra Quick Drain Standard RV Sewer Hose 20ft, Bagged is the bagged storage solution. This is a practical addition that keeps the hose organized and prevents dirt from spreading. The hose itself is designed with standard 3″ bayonet fittings, making it compatible with virtually all RV sewer adapters and dump station ports.
There aren’t really customization options for the hose itself. It’s a fixed length with specific fittings, designed for straightforward application. However, users can choose to purchase complementary accessories like rubber seals for the fittings, different types of sewer adapters (e.g., threaded adapters for dump stations that require them), or hose supports to maintain a consistent downward slope, which can be beneficial in certain situations.
